KYield, a pioneering company on a mission to redefine governance and decision-making through advanced technology, has successfully raised $2 million in its latest funding round. Designed to empower organizations and individuals to navigate the complexities of the knowledge yield curve, KYield鈥檚 innovative platforms facilitate precision governance while ensuring data accuracy and security. This new funding will enhance the development of key products like the KOS, a modular distributed AI operating system that streamlines enterprise-wide governance, and the KYield Healthcare Platform, which optimizes preventative care and has gained recognition for its potential in self-insured employer healthcare. With renewed interest from government entities and insurers for more efficient healthcare systems, KYield is positioned to lead the charge in safeguarding public health. Additionally, the newly developed HumCat focuses on preventing human-caused catastrophes by bundling prevention strategies with financial incentives, targeting organizations eager to maximize their ROI through crisis aversion. The company is also gearing up for the awaited introduction of its Synthetic Genius Machine and Knowledge Creation System, promising cutting-edge advancements in AI and quantum computing. This recent infusion of capital will not only accelerate research and development across these high-impact initiatives but also solidify KYield's position as a leader in systems of integrity, ultimately enhancing productivity and competitiveness for its clients across various sectors.
